Today's recipe:

Cut a moderately sized peeled sweet potato and a deseeded red pepper into chunks. Drizzle with olive oil, menace with ground black pepper, shuffle them about on a baking tray/overproof dish and put in the oven at gas mark 4 for about 45 minutes.

Cut a small head of broccoli into florets, and split the florets up by slicing through the stalk vertically. Throw onto the baking tray, do some more shuffling about to get a little oil onto the broccoli, and put it back in the oven for 15-20 minutes.

Remove, leave to cool. Put half in your Dalek baitbox, scatter with a good handful of pumpkin seeds and take to work. Put the other half in a margarine tub in the fridge for tomorrow.

Timings are (very) approximate. I was cleaning the kitchen and doing some hoovering while it was cooking and wasn't paying a lot of attention. Make sure the sweet potato is at least mostly soft throughout before putting the broccoli in. Our oven temperature is also very approximate and inconsistent. If you can hear violent sizzling noises, turn it down a bit.
